在当前的前端开发领域,TypeScript因其强类型、易维护等特点,已经成为许多开发者的首选。本文将带你一步步搭建一个TypeScript项目,从基础环境搭建到运行部署,让你对TypeScript项目有一个全面的认识。
一、基础环境搭建
1. 安装Node.js
首先,你需要安装Node.js,因为TypeScript需要Node.js环境来运行。你可以从Node.js官网下载适合你操作系统的版本,并进行安装。
2. 安装TypeScript
安装TypeScript可以通过Node.js的包管理器npm来完成。打开命令行工具,运行以下命令:
npm install -g typescript
这会将TypeScript命令行工具安装到全局范围内。
3. 创建项目目录
创建一个项目目录,用于存放你的TypeScript代码。
mkdir my-typescript-project
cd my-typescript-project
4. 初始化项目
在项目目录中,创建一个tsconfig.json文件,这是TypeScript项目的配置文件。你可以使用以下命令生成一个默认的tsconfig.json:
tsc --init
这会生成一个包含基本配置的tsconfig.json文件。
5. 编写代码
在你的项目目录中创建一个名为index.ts的文件,并编写你的TypeScript代码。
console.log('Hello, TypeScript!');
二、编译与运行
1. 编译
在命令行工具中,运行以下命令来编译你的TypeScript代码:
tsc
这会将index.ts编译成JavaScript代码,并生成一个index.js文件。
2. 运行
现在,你可以使用Node.js运行编译后的JavaScript代码:
node index.js
你将在控制台看到“Hello, TypeScript!”的输出。
三、开发工具集成
为了提高开发效率,你可以将TypeScript项目集成到IDE中。以下是一些流行的IDE和其集成方式:
1. Visual Studio Code
在Visual Studio Code中,你可以通过以下步骤来集成TypeScript:
- 打开VS Code。
- 点击左下角的扩展按钮。
- 在搜索框中输入“TypeScript”。
- 安装“TypeScript”扩展。
- 在VS Code中打开你的项目目录。
2. WebStorm
在WebStorm中,你可以通过以下步骤来集成TypeScript:
- 打开WebStorm。
- 点击“File” -> “Open”。
- 选择你的项目目录。
- WebStorm会自动识别并配置TypeScript项目。
四、运行与部署
1. 运行
在本地开发环境中,你可以使用Node.js来运行你的TypeScript项目。但是,如果你想要在生产环境中运行,你需要将编译后的JavaScript代码部署到服务器上。
2. 部署
以下是一些常用的部署方式:
- 使用云服务提供商,如阿里云、腾讯云等。
- 使用静态网站托管服务,如GitHub Pages、Netlify等。
- 使用容器化技术,如Docker。
五、总结
本文从基础环境搭建到运行部署,详细介绍了TypeScript项目的构建过程。通过学习本文,你将能够独立搭建一个TypeScript项目,并将其部署到生产环境中。希望这篇文章能帮助你更好地了解TypeScript,开启你的TypeScript之旅!
